Rated 1 out of 5 stars

Dishonest and scam-like pricing and billing model, with seemingly intentionally unhelpful support

A couple of things before I start.

The tools by this company are provided via web page. I did not see an available app.

I would advise, based off of what I'm going to explain, not to use the service.

I will try to be concise as not to lose your attention.

I saw that this service was on sale. I had been seeing lots of ads on Facebook for CodeFinity teaching python and I thought it would be worth a try at the reduced price.

The price that is normally around $200 was reduced to $96. I purchased it and was ready to go.

There was a screen that asked if I wanted to use the Python package or something along those lines. That's what I had clicked into, and I had just paid, so yes. That's what I'm choosing to use.

I clicked a button and it got started.

I then received notifications that I was charged $96 and $103.

Looking more closely at the order information the next day, at some point along the way they tacked on $103. I found out later from their support that this was for an upgrade. Apparently when I clicked that I wanted the Python package, I was immediately charged.

There was no check out.
There was no question as to whether or not I was sure about the purchase, stating that it would cost me $103.

It just charged me immediately.

It's funny because that $103 is almost exactly $96 plus tax. So at first when I saw the $103 I thought that was the price with tax but it didn't make sense because my original order did not show tax.

A day or two later, I contacted their support because I had seen that it was two charges. I spoke to their support person and they were immediately helpful about removing the $103 stating that I could stay on their platform and everything would be unlocked for me at $96.

I had already seen their money back guarantee which is absolutely ridiculous. Effectively, you have to use codefinity for 28 days and then after those 28 days, they verify whether or not you spent those 28 days using their service before accepting that you can get a refund. It seems basically impossible to guarantee and for a service that you find you don't like or can't learn from, you have to spend 28 days anyway using it. So let's say it's miserable and you realize that within the first 3 days. You don't get your money back unless you spend 25 more days using it.

Still, I contacted support and asked them for a refund because I had not used their service, and wouldn't be using their service, and they refunded the $103. However, I asked for a full refund including the $96. We went back and forth several times where they pretended they didn't understand what I was asking for repeatedly reiterating that they had already refunded my $103 and that they are being good enough to allow me access to their website in full with no upgrade charge.

They referred to it as the accidental upgrade charge.

I told them that I felt their practices were dishonest and explained why multiple times. That was why I wanted a full refund. I would not support their company because it's obvious, especially looking back over reviews on Reddit, that it is their intent to this even you into believing you are getting access to their site at a discounted rate only to upcharge you as soon as you go in without notifying you that it's happening.

We went back and forth for a while. I remained calm and patient. By the end of my patience I made it clear that it would be my last communication and the next communication they got from me would be via the better Business bureau.

They demonstrated they had understood what I wanted the whole time and immediately refunded my $96 as well.

Is a scam for a service that should not require scamming people. They simply just can't help themselves to your money.

I would suggest looking elsewhere for programming practice.
